Step into history with Dunhaven, one of the most distinguished homes in Glasgow built in 1837 by William Dunnica, one of Glasgow's original founders. This grand residence originally stood as a full plantation estate occupying an entire city block. Remodeled in 1908 adding a gallery porch with elegant 2 Story rusticated concrete columns-a design popularized after the 1904 St. Louis World's Fair, now a rare architectural feature in Missouri. Glasgow is located in Missouri. Glasgow, Missouri has a population of 1,075. Glasgow is more family-centric than the surrounding county with 25.82% of the households containing married families with children. The county average for households married with children is 25.46%.
The median household income in Glasgow, Missouri is $47,589. The median household income for the surrounding county is $58,596 compared to the national median of $69,021. The median age of people living in Glasgow is 44.9 years.
The average high temperature in July is 88.2 degrees, with an average low temperature in January of 18.6 degrees. The average rainfall is approximately 42.8 inches per year, with 15.3 inches of snow per year.
